Typical Elements in Obituaries
Obituaries typically include the deceased’s full name, date of birth, and date of death. A concise biographical sketch often follows, highlighting key life events, achievements, and personal attributes. Family relationships are usually mentioned, and often, details about the funeral service, including time, location, and reception arrangements, are included. These elements collectively form a comprehensive narrative of the deceased’s life.
Common Wording Choices and Tone
The language employed in obituaries is typically respectful, reflective, and celebratory. Words like “loving,” “devoted,” and “cherished” are frequently used to express the deceased’s positive impact on the lives of those they touched. The tone often strives for a balance between grief and celebration, acknowledging the loss while also highlighting the life lived. Avoidance of overly emotional language is common.

Memorial Services and Ceremonies
Memorial services and ceremonies offer diverse ways to commemorate a life. These events provide an opportunity for sharing memories, expressing condolences, and celebrating the life lived. A traditional service might involve a eulogy, hymns, prayers, and a viewing of the deceased. Alternatively, a more contemporary approach could incorporate music, video tributes, or personal reflections from loved ones.
The choice often depends on the family’s wishes and the desired tone for the occasion.
- Traditional Services: These often adhere to established religious or cultural customs, involving prayers, readings, and hymns. Examples include funeral masses, religious services, or rites adhering to specific cultural traditions. These services may include a viewing or visitation period before the service.
- Celebration of Life Services: These services focus on the positive aspects of the deceased’s life, emphasizing joy, laughter, and memorable moments. They often incorporate personal anecdotes, photos, music, and video tributes. This approach allows the family to highlight the unique qualities and contributions of their loved one.
- Memorial Gatherings: These events are less formal and can be held in a variety of settings, such as a park, garden, or a family home. They are often centered around sharing memories and enjoying refreshments.
Memorial Products
Memorial products offer tangible ways to keep a loved one’s memory alive. These can range from traditional to contemporary, catering to diverse tastes and budgets. Consideration should be given to the desired permanence, aesthetic appeal, and sentimental value.
- Keepsakes: These include personalized items such as photo albums, framed photographs, or custom-designed jewelry. Keepsakes are often treasured mementos that allow individuals to carry a piece of their loved one’s memory with them.
- Memorial Monuments: These can include traditional headstones, personalized markers, or elaborate mausoleums. These monuments serve as lasting tributes and often provide a place for families to gather and reflect.
- Memorial Trees: Planting a tree in memory of a loved one can symbolize growth, resilience, and the enduring spirit of life. This provides a lasting, natural memorial.
Cost Comparison of Memorialization Choices, Shaw-majercik funeral home obituaries
The costs associated with memorialization vary significantly depending on the chosen options. Factors such as the type of service, the complexity of the memorial products, and the desired level of personalization all play a role in determining the overall expenses.
Memorialization Option | Approximate Cost Range (USD) |
---|---|
Traditional Funeral Service | $5,000 – $15,000+ |
Celebration of Life Service | $2,000 – $8,000+ |
Memorial Gathering | $500 – $3,000+ |
Simple Headstone | $1,000 – $3,000 |
Custom Keepsake | $100 – $1,000+ |
Memorial Tree | $50 – $500+ |
Note: These are estimated ranges and actual costs may vary depending on specific circumstances and choices.
